Understanding the Intricacies of Contested Divorce
- Definition of Contested Divorce: A contested divorce, as the term suggests, is a type of divorce where the two parties involved cannot reach a consensus on certain key issues. These issues could range from child custody and alimony to division of property and debt settlement. In such cases, the intervention of a court becomes necessary to resolve the disputes. The process of a contested divorce is often protracted, stressful, and expensive due to the involvement of multiple court hearings and legal negotiations. It is in such complex situations that the role of Contested Divorce Lawyers in Chandigarh becomes indispensable.
- Procedure of Contested Divorce: The procedure for a contested divorce typically begins with one spouse (the petitioner) filing for divorce in the court. The other spouse (the respondent) is then served with the divorce papers and given a stipulated period to respond. If the respondent fails to respond within the given time frame, the court may grant a default judgment in favor of the petitioner. However, if the respondent contests the divorce or any of its terms, the case proceeds to trial. The trial involves presentation of evidence, examination and cross-examination of witnesses, and legal arguments. At the end of the trial, the court makes a final decision on all contested issues.
